Welcome to My Online Community

Welcome to the online home of Jillian Amodio, a passionate advocate for mental health, inclusive education, and social justice. With 16 years of experience as a writer, therapist, and educator, Jillian is dedicated to empowering youth and breaking down stigmas surrounding mental health and sexuality.

This site serves as a resource for those seeking knowledge, support, and community. Whether you’re here to explore Jillian’s upcoming book, access mental health resources, or engage with interactive content, you’ll find a space dedicated to fostering inclusivity, wellness, and informed decision-making.

Powerfully Prepared is a comprehensive guide designed to provide youth with inclusive, modern sex education. It covers topics such as gender, sexuality, body confidence, and mental health, ensuring young people are empowered with the knowledge they need to navigate these important subjects in a positive, informed way.

The book is primarily written for adolescents and young adults, but it’s also a great resource for parents, educators, and anyone seeking a more inclusive approach to sex education. It offers advice and insights that are accessible and engaging for both youth and their families.

Unlike traditional sex education books, Powerfully Prepared takes an inclusive and holistic approach. It covers often overlooked topics such as cultural differences, gender diversity, and disabilities, while also providing interactive elements like quizzes to make learning more engaging and relatable.

In addition to her work as an author, Jillian is a licensed therapist (LMSW) who offers therapy for adolescents, couples, and families. She also leads workshops on mental health, mindfulness, and sex education, providing support and education both locally and online.

You can sign up on the website to be notified when pre-orders open. Simply leave your email, and you’ll receive updates on the book’s release and any special offers for early purchasers.

Inclusive sex education ensures that every individual, regardless of their gender, sexuality, or background, has access to accurate information that reflects their experiences. It empowers young people to make informed, healthy choices and helps reduce stigma around important topics like mental health, gender identity, and consent.
